Output 33bfdff6beee8c19307c8cc7e58d17fe7d4311d85490e9c2d6935de4db435f5a:0

value
707444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03d2321c916ddac71549331b3f76f925124d2dd OP_EQUAL
address
3N8gXQLsc6poCp6eaYjM352gKPx18Vw23u
transaction
33bfdff6beee8c19307c8cc7e58d17fe7d4311d85490e9c2d6935de4db435f5a
confirmations
173562
spent
true